CITT Order – Safeguard Surtax exclusion inquiry #3 on heavy steel plate & S/S wire

The Canadian International Trade Tribunal (CITT), on May 19, 2019, on the recommendation of the Minister of Finance began to conduct periodic inquiries regarding exclusion requests concerning certain heavy plate and stainless steel wire which are subject to safeguard surtax measures.

On November 10, 2020, the CITT presented its final report on the third such inquiry.

The Tribunal received a request for exclusion from only one company in this inquiry – Industrial Process Products Ltd (IPP), for certain stainless steel wire.

There were no requests regarding heavy plate.

Based on the information submitted in IPP’s exclusion request, the CITT has recommended that the exclusion request be denied.

Complete details of the inquiry are contained in CITT’s Safeguard Inquiries Report.
